Senior Physiotherapist

Job Description: We are seeking a highly skilled

Senior Physiotherapist

to join our client's team in South West England. As a key member of the multidisciplinary team, you will be responsible for providing specialist physiotherapy assessment and treatment plans for patients with complex needs.

Key Responsibilities: • To manage patients with diverse or complex presentations/multi pathologies and provide specialist physiotherapy assessment and treatment plans. • To maintain accurate and comprehensive patient treatment records in line with CSP standards and local/Trust policy. • To undertake a comprehensive assessment of patients and provide an accurate clinical diagnosis of their condition using advanced clinical reasoning skills and manual assessment techniques. • To formulate and deliver an individual physiotherapy treatment programme based on a sound knowledge of evidence-based practice and treatment options. • To take delegated responsibility from the Band 7 physiotherapist for managing patients with particular conditions and provide specialist physiotherapy assessment and treatment plans. • To assess patient understanding of treatment proposals, gain valid informed consent, and develop comprehensive management plans.

Skills and Qualifications: • Degree (BSc Hons Physiotherapy) or equivalent qualification. • HCPC registration. • Proven attendance at additional relevant professional courses. • Demonstrates effective and adaptable communication skills including written and verbal. • Ability to recognise own limitations and act on them. • Proven evidence of personal leadership.
